The cheapest way to get from Doolin to Carraroe is to bus which costs €15 - €23 and takes 3h 36m.
The fastest way to get from Doolin to Carraroe is to drive which takes 1h 44m and costs €19 - €28.
No, there is no direct bus from Doolin to Carraroe. However, there are services departing from Doolin and arriving at An Cheathrú Rua via Galway Ceannt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 36m.
The distance between Doolin and Carraroe is 116 km. The road distance is 113.5 km.
The best way to get from Doolin to Carraroe without a car is to bus which takes 3h 36m and costs €15 - €23.
It takes approximately 3h 36m to get from Doolin to Carraroe, including transfers.
